10 must-have tools for managing your startup effectively
Starting and running a startup can be both exhilarating and challenging. To effectively manage the difficulties of entrepreneurship successfully, you need the right tools at your disposal. In this blog post, we’ll explore ten must-have tools that can help you manage your startup effectively.
Business plan software
A robust business plan is essential for every startup. Tools like LivePlan or Bizplan can assist you in creating, editing, and sharing your business plan with potential investors and team members.
System builder tools
Create systems that will help scale your startup using tools like Notion and Coda.
Accounting software
Managing finances is critical. QuickBooks and FreshBooks can help you keep track of income, expenses, and taxes, simplifying your financial management.
Project management tools
Stay organized and on top of your tasks with project management software like Trello, Asana, or Monday.com. These tools make it simple to delegate tasks, set deadlines, and monitor progress.
Marketing tools
Maintain a solid online presence with social media management platforms like Hootsuite or Buffer. These tools help you schedule posts, track engagement, and analyze your social media performance. In addition, utilize MailChimp or Apollo to create and manage email campaigns to reach your audience effectively. Remember to leverage email, as it is a powerful marketing tool to help scale your startup.
Customer relationship management (CRM) software
Tools like HubSpot or Salesforce allow you to manage your customer interactions, track leads, and nurture relationships with potential clients.
Communication tools
Foster effective communication among your team members and clients with tools like Slack or Zoom for video conferencing and messaging.
Analytics tools
Understand your website’s performance and user behavior with tools like Google Analytics. These insights are invaluable for making data-driven decisions.
Cybersecurity tools
Protect your startup from cyber threats with tools like Norton, McAfee, or a virtual private network (VPN).
File storage and sharing
Collaborate with your team and share important documents securely using cloud storage solutions like Google Drive or Dropbox.
These ten tools cover essential aspects of managing a startup. The specific tools you choose may depend on your business’s unique needs and budget. By utilizing these must-have tools, you’ll be better equipped to streamline your operations, increase efficiency, and ultimately, increase your chances of startup success.
